介绍
Shadowsocks是一种基于Socks5代理协议的网络加密传输工具,能够有效绕过网络封锁,提供安全、稳定的上网体验。本教程将向您展示如何在Azure VM上安装和配置Shadowsocks。
步骤一:创建Azure VM
- 登录Azure门户网站
- 选择虚拟机服务
- 点击“创建虚拟机”按钮
步骤二:选择VM配置
- 选择适合您需求的虚拟机配置,包括操作系统、大小、存储等
- 设置网络和安全组规则
步骤三:安装Shadowsocks
- 连接到您的Azure VM
- 打开终端或命令行界面
- 安装Shadowsocks软件
步骤四:配置Shadowsocks
- 编辑Shadowsocks配置文件
- 设置服务器地址、端口、密码等参数
- 保存配置文件并启动Shadowsocks
步骤五:测试Shadowsocks连接
- 在本地设备上安装Shadowsocks客户端
- 使用Shadowsocks客户端连接到您的Azure VM
- 测试网络连接是否正常
常见问题解答
如何解决Shadowsocks连接超时的问题?
- 检查Azure VM的防火墙设置,确保允许Shadowsocks的端口通过
- 检查Shadowsocks配置文件中的服务器地址和端口是否正确
- 尝试更改Shadowsocks的加密方式或协议
如何解决Shadowsocks连接速度慢的问题?
- 检查Azure VM的网络带宽限制,确保带宽足够
- 尝试更换Shadowsocks服务器的位置或供应商
- 调整Shadowsocks客户端的连接设置,如超时时间和多线程连接数
如何在多台设备上使用同一个Shadowsocks账号?
- 在Shadowsocks客户端上添加多个配置文件,每个配置文件对应一个设备
- 将Azure VM的Shadowsocks配置文件复制到其他设备上
- 使用相同的服务器地址、端口和密码连接
如何确保Shadowsocks连接的安全性?
- 使用强密码,并定期更换密码
- 更新Shadowsocks软件和操作系统补丁,以防止安全漏洞
- 使用HTTPS代理或VPN加密整个网络连接
结论
通过本教程,您已经学会在Azure VM上安装和配置Shadowsocks,享受安全、稳定的上网体验。
如果您有其他问题,请查阅我们的常见问题解答或咨询相关技术支持。
正文完